Dead Jealous- Helen Durrant- 3*
A girl’s body is found in the boot of  car. No one in the local area appears to know anything, or at least are being cagey about their answers to the police questions. A loan shark runs the local neighbourhood. Years beforehand a young girl went missing and was never found. When articles relating to her are discovered by accident the case re surfaces. A well written book with enough punch to keep the reader interested. Some background to characters and a little of their life story always makes them more real. An enjoyable read.I voluntarily chose to read this ARC and all opinions in this review are my own and completely unbiased
